From 338ca677e2c845ceab556c18860dbffb707360bb Mon Sep 17 00:00:00 2001 From: jliddev Date: Mon, 19 Apr 2021 08:57:08 -0500 Subject: [PATCH] Fix #835 App should now roll back an addon update if unzipping fails --- wowup-electron/src/app/services/addons/addon.service.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/wowup-electron/src/app/services/addons/addon.service.ts b/wowup-electron/src/app/services/addons/addon.service.ts index 75eb0b79..b820d6df 100644 --- a/wowup-electron/src/app/services/addons/addon.service.ts +++ b/wowup-electron/src/app/services/addons/addon.service.ts @@ -617,9 +617,9 @@ export class AddonService { }); const unzipPath = path.join(this._wowUpService.applicationDownloadsFolderPath, uuidv4()); - unzippedDirectory = await this._fileService.unzipFile(downloadedFilePath, unzipPath); try { + unzippedDirectory = await this._fileService.unzipFile(downloadedFilePath, unzipPath); await this.installUnzippedDirectory(unzippedDirectory, installation); } catch (err) { console.error(err);